but with a little messing around and entering 'scorpion king' i got this
"http://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Scorpion_king
King Serket, translated as King Scorpion or sometimes The Scorpion King, refers to one or two kings of Upper Egypt during the Protodynastic Period. His name may refer to the goddess Serket.
The only pictoral evidence of his existence is a macehead found in the main deposit in a temple at Nekhen. He is believed to have lived just before or during the rule of Narmer at Thinis. He may have been a local king of Nekhen who had nothing to do with the ruling house of Thinis or a rival from within that family. Another theory makes him identical to Narmer as an alternate name.
Recently a 5000 year old graffito has been discovered by Professor John Darnell of Yale University that also bears the symbols of King Scorpion and depicts his defeat of another predynastic ruler. The image was recorded and shown in a History Channel special.[1]
Serket's name was borrowed for the 2002 movie The Scorpion King."
